How do I make VS Code default Mac?
- From the Mac Finder application, choose a file and Get Info on it, such as a . php, or other file type.
- From the Get Info window, select Visual Studio Code as the Open With option.
- Choose Change All to make this the default application for all files of type X ( in this case PHP).

How do I change the default terminal in VS Code Mac?
- Open Visual Studio Code.
- Press CTRL + SHIFT + P to open the Command Palette.
- Search for “Terminal: Select Default Profile” (previously “Terminal: Select Default Shell”)
- Select your preferred shell. In my case I selected “Git Bash”

How do I restart VS Code?
- Open the command palette ( Ctrl + Shift + P ) and execute the command: >Reload Window.
- Define a keybinding for the command (for example CTRL + F5 ) in keybindings.json : [ { “key”: “ctrl+f5”, “command”: “workbench.action.reloadWindow”, “when”: “editorTextFocus” } ]

How do you show hidden files on Mac?
View Hidden Files in Finder
In Finder, you can click your hard drive under Locations, then open your Macintosh HD folder. Press Command + Shift + . (period) to make the hidden files appear. You can also do the same from inside the Documents, Applications, and Desktop folders.

Can I uninstall Microsoft edge?
Microsoft Edge is the web browser recommended by Microsoft and is the default web browser for Windows. Because Windows supports applications that rely on the web platform, our default web browser is an essential component of our operating system and can’t be uninstalled.

What is Mac HD?
macOS Catalina runs on a dedicated, read-only system volume called Macintosh HD. This volume is completely separate from all other data to help prevent the accidental overwriting of critical operating system files. Your files and data are stored in another volume named Macintosh HD – Data.
